Orca
"Terror just beneath the surface."
Originally released in 1977. Orca is a horror/thriller film. directed by Michael Anderson.
Starring Richard Harris, Charlotte Rampling, and Will Sampson
Synopsis
After witnessing the killing of his mate and offspring at the hands of a reckless Irish captain, a vengeful killer whale rampages through the fisherman's Newfoundland harbor. Under pressure from the villagers, the captain, a female marine biologist, and an Indigenous tribalist venture after the great beast, who will meet them on its own turf.
